Fifth grader helps collect coats, blankets for the homeless
Las Vegas, NV (KTNV) -- A Valley fifth grader is working hard to make his community a better place to live.
Blaze Trumble is 9-years-old and from Boulder City. He has been collecting new or clean or gently used blankets and jackets for the homeless in the Las Vegas area.
Blaze began his mission when he was only 5-years-old, when he decided helping the homeless was his birthday wish.
Last year's collection reached more than 600 and Blaze hopes to surpass that number this year. He will distribute everything he collected at the Las Vegas Rescue Mission.
